MILLION GRANT TO HELP IMPROVE FOOD SAFETY IN BEEF, DAIRY 1xbet online casino SYSTEMS

MANHATTAN -- A Kansas State University epidemiologist 1xbet online casino use a million grant from the U.S. Department of Agriculture for improving food safety in beef and dairy cattle systems in the U.S. and Canada.

H. Morgan Scott, a professor in K-State's department of diagnostic medicine and pathobiology, will collaborate on the project with researchers from the University of Guelph, Angelo State University, Texas Tech University, Texas A&M University, Cornell University, Colorado State University and the Public Health Agency of Canada. The progress and achievements of the integrated project 1xbet online casino evaluated by K-State's office of educational innovation and evaluation.

&1xbet online casino ;Our overall goal is to identify, evaluate and implement practical interventions for managing antibiotic resistance in beef and dairy cattle systems,&1xbet online casino ; Scott said. &1xbet online casino ;We focus on the longstanding problem of resistance emergence, dissemination and persistence among enteric bacteria. If pathogenic bacteria resistant to antibiotics enter the food chain, treatment of humans can be complicated.&1xbet online casino ;

Scott said researchers 1xbet online casino use a variety of methods to assess, and then improve, the quality of education and extension materials, such as veterinary curricula and commodity specific prudent-use guidelines.

&1xbet online casino ;Threats to the continued use of several common agricultural formulations of antimicrobials are looming in the form of FDA guidance documents and draft federal legislation,&1xbet online casino ; Scott said. &1xbet online casino ;Having scientifically proven tools available to veterinarians and producers to counter bacterial resistance where and when it arises is essential to maintaining public trust in our abilities to manage threats to public health.&1xbet online casino ;

The costs to animal agriculture 1xbet online casino tremendous if certain classes or uses of antibiotics are no longer available, Scott said.

&1xbet online casino ;The use of antibiotics for treatment and prevention of bacterial infections in beef and dairy cattle is essential for producing safe and wholesome food for consumers, for maximizing the welfare of animals, and for sustaining profitability in animal agriculture,&1xbet online casino ; he said.

&1xbet online casino ;We want to employ molecular microbiology to discover the mechanisms underlying several paradoxical responses of resistant strains to antibiotic selection pressures,&1xbet online casino ; Scott said. &1xbet online casino ;Next it will be critical to field-test practical interventions designed to effectively manage antibiotic resistance levels in production, as well as near-slaughter phases of beef and dairy cattle systems.&1xbet online casino ;

Scientifically proven interventions 1xbet online casino shared with interested parties and decision makers in the cattle industry, who 1xbet online casino encouraged to further evaluate those methods in their production systems, Scott said. Decision makers also 1xbet online casino warned of ineffective interventions.

Scott said collaborating with other schools and working outside the research lab are important parts of the project. He and his lab students 1xbet online casino visit feed yards and dairy production facilities to work directly with cattle.

&1xbet online casino ;We plan to develop an integrated model to assess the temporal dynamics of antibiotic resistance and evaluate the effectiveness of interventions to mitigate its dissemination in cattle systems,&1xbet online casino ; Scott said. &1xbet online casino ;This model will be available for education and extension purposes as a very effective demonstration tool. We also hope this will greatly enhance detection of early-resistant E. coli, and we will be able to better estimate animal-level prevalence of resistance carriage through enhanced surveillance. We expect that our new approach will yield earlier detection and characterization of resistance to critically important antibiotics.&1xbet online casino ;
